Professional, Tech
174 days ago
DevOps Engineer

You’re a coder and love coding. You have a passion for learning to better yourself through your coding. Automation and the value it brings amazes you and you get your kicks from delivering systems to the customer. You take pride in delivering world-class reliable and scalable systems

Expectations of you:

As a member of the engineering team, you will deliver robust and efficient engineering practice as directed by business constraints while respecting controls. As the engineer, you are expected to:

Delivery of coding practices and automation while meeting quality criteria and project constraints

Explore and try different methods to improve productivity and efficiency of the team

Ensure alignment to Chief Architect roadmaps and strategies

Meet service levels for systems (availability, security, and performance)

Influence the direction of the overall architecture

Understand the public and private cloud concepts especially compute, network, storage and data

Understand cloud native application architectures and micro-services

Critical attention to detail about code, troubleshooting, efficiency and design

Develop and maintain standards of software development, components, and release management

Identify and reduce technical debt

Be able to communicate effectively – verbal and written

Be able to work alone or with others as needs dictate

Take ownership of all assigned tasks

Take ownership of systems and services assigned in production

Be proactive in promoting ‘Best Practices’

Be available for out of hours support as required

Responsibilities:

Coding & Platform Delivery

Write lots of code

Review lots of code

Accelerate timelines while balancing quality and simplicity

Execute and improve on controls and coding practice

Support

Implement reliable systems

Timely resolution of incidents and problems

Root cause analysis and remediation

Manage technical debt

Communication of changes

Leadership

Help other developers

Share knowledge on codebase

Ensure compliance with ING standards

Requirements:

Demonstrated experience in delivering mission critical systems

Demonstrated experience to design and implement public/private cloud

Demonstrated experience in mentoring other developers

Demonstrated experience leading efficient and operational 24/7 large scale system support

Communication (written/verbal) to be well developed and of a professional standard

Ability to operate at own initiative with a pro-active attitude, within the directions and confines of management and Bank policy

Ability to liaise with a broad range of people, including line management, senior management, external suppliers and related people.

Strong problem solving ability and strong analytical skills

Experience working in an agile development lifecycle

Confirm your E-mail: Send Email